Adolf Merckle, owner of Ratiopharm, commits suicide
We were shocked today to read that the owner of both Ratiopharm, one of Europe’s largest generics companies and Phoenix PharmaHandel, Europe’s 2nd largest drug distributor, has committed suicide as a result of having lost billions of euros on the stock markets. Despite his great fortune, the losses on his recent bets in VW shares proved too great to salvage and led to this event.
Mr. Merckle’s success at developing the generics market can only be admired, helping to lower the cost of medicines for millions of people and increasing awareness about generics in general. Our condolences go out to the Merckle family and the employees of Ratiopharm and Phoenix PharmaHandel.
